I'm reposting old pics for anyone who is curious about my twist on the flexiboard/torsion bar chassis.

This was going to be my entry for the World Can Am Proxy Race but I hit a snag at the last minute. Legal front tires wouldn't fit under the front fenders! blink.gif

The side pans are .063" thick in order to add a lot or weight around the perimeter. The wheelbase and the distance from the rear wheels to the front guide pivot post was also probably too short for optimum handling.

The original project was to be a low budget chassis for a 36D motor and was to to go under a 1964 Mercury Marauder hard body stock car. I changed my mind and switched to the Chappy 2G body which was too low for the 36D motor:

The front axle tube has been replaced with a solid independent unit and the motor mount and wing uprights have been added.

Next a few wires, a llittle bit of paint...(edit: no wires...no paint...the Pittman 6001BB is the only decent legal motor I will have for next year's Thingie Proxy Race so the 2G project is sitting at the bottom of the "things to do" bin)
